Bourse Direct Enterprise Introduction

What Is BOURSE DIRECT?

BOURSE DIRECT Is A Non-regulated Brokerage Based In France That Offers A Wide Range Of Trading Instruments Across Different Asset Classes. These Include Stocks, UCITS, Warrants, CFDs And Forex. The Company Offers Free Trading Accounts With No Minimum Deposit Requirements, Making It Suitable For Traders At All Levels. It Also Offers A Convenient Trading Platform Through The Web And Mobile Apps, Enabling Traders To Execute Trades And Monitor Market Dynamics From Anywhere.

Advantages:

No Minimum Deposit Requirement: Unlike Some Other Brokerage Firms That May Require A Minimum Deposit In Order To Open An Account, BOURSE DIRECT Has No Minimum Deposit Requirement. This Makes It Available To All Levels Of Traders, Including Those With Limited Funds.

Free Account: BOURSE DIRECT Does Not Charge Any Custody, Subscription Or Account Maintenance Fees. This Means Traders Can Enjoy Trading Without Worrying About Holding Or Managing Their Accounts.

Multiple Customer Support Channels: BOURSE DIRECT Offers Multiple Customer Support Channels Including Phone, Email, Address, Social Media And Contact Forms (24/7 Support), Improving Customer Accessibility And Assistance.

Cons:

Lack Of Regulation: The Lack Of Effective Regulation Raises Significant Security And Trust Issues, And Regulatory Oversight Is Essential To Ensure Customer Protection And Platform Transparency. There Are Also Reports Of Inability To Withdraw Cash And Scams, Adding To The Platform's Shortcomings.

NO DEMO ACCOUNT: BOURSE DIRECT Does Not Offer A Demo Account, Which Can Be A Disadvantage For New Traders Who Wish To Practice Their Trading Strategies And Familiarize Themselves With The Platform, As They Cannot Practice Without Risk.

MARKET TOOLS

STOCK: BOURSE DIRECT Provides Access To A Variety Of Stocks, Allowing Investors To Trade Shares Of Listed Companies On A Variety Of Stock Markets. This Includes Stocks From Major Global Markets As Well As Regional Markets.

UCITS (Collective Investment Scheme For Transferable Securities): BOURSE DIRECT Provides Regulated UCITS At The European Union Level, Providing Investors With The Opportunity To Diversify Their Portfolios Through Professionally Managed Funds.

Warrants: Investors Can Trade Warrants Through BOURSE DIRECT, A Derivative Financial Instrument That Gives The Holder The Right, But Not The Obligation, To Buy Or Sell The Underlying Asset By A Predetermined Maturity Date Prior To A Specified Price.

Contracts For Difference: BOURSE DIRECT Allows Trading Of Contracts For Difference, A Derivative Product That Allows Traders To Speculate On Price Fluctuations In Various Financial Instruments Without Owning The Underlying Asset. CFD Trading Offers The Opportunity To Profit In Both Rising And Falling Markets.

Forex (Forex Trading): BOURSE DIRECT Provides Access To The Forex Market Where Traders Can Buy And Sell Currency Pairs. Forex Trading Involves Exchanging One Currency For Another At An Agreed Price, Enabling Investors To Take Advantage Of Exchange Rate Fluctuations Between Different Currencies.

Accounts

BOURSE DIRECT Offers A Variety Of Types Of Accounts With User-friendly Features And Advantages. Opening A Stock Exchange Account Is Free And Can Be Done Conveniently Online With The Opening Of Securities, PEA (Stock Savings Plan) And PEA-PMEaccounts. For Corporate And Investment Club Accounts, Account Opening Documents Need To Be Completed. In Addition, If An Account Transfer Is Made, Bourse Direct Will Bear Your Full Costs, Up To €200 Per Account.

All Accounts Offered By BOURSE DIRECT Have The Following Advantages:

No Minimum Deposit Requirement.

No Escrow Fees.

No Subscription Fees.

No Account Maintenance Fees.
